  11. I disagree strongly that these events are a novelty. They may be new to NZ but not the rest of the world where straight out trotting reigns supreme. If you watch races from Scandinavia and especially France you will see many monte races on a programme racing for equal or better prize money. Horses were not born with carts on them and trotted freely before restraints with harness were placed on them. The great trotter Greyhound voted trotter of the century raced ocassionally in monte races so it has a long history. NZ is only getting up to play with the world and I hope they continue to promote them and trainers support them. Have seen several live in Aus and they are a great spectacles and the same as any betting medium when you follow them and who are the better riders.
